Top Destinations for Villas Close to Horseback Riding
Across the globe, several destinations shine for both their riding opportunities and selection of stunning villas. In Costa Rica’s Tamarindo, for example, visitors enjoy sweeping vistas of Pacific coastline and rugged mountains. Here, horseback tours wind through tropical forests, along palm-fringed beaches, and up into tranquil hills. The villas in this area balance exclusivity and immersion in nature. We can enjoy modern comforts while feeling close enough to ride out at sunrise and return for a cooling swim by mid-morning.
Other sought-after spots include southern Spain’s Andalusian countryside, famed for whitewashed estates bordering miles of bridle paths, as well as Tuscany in Italy, where rolling vineyards and medieval towns frame unforgettable rides. In each location, the best villas are thoughtfully positioned so every day starts and ends in a space designed for both relaxation and adventure.

Tips for Booking the Right Villa
Selecting the right villa takes more than scrolling through beautiful photos. It helps to ask a few pointed questions before confirming your reservation:
- How close are horseback tour providers? Walking distance is ideal, especially for early morning departures.
- What’s included in the stay? Details like housekeeping, breakfast service, or concierge assistance can make a significant difference in our day-to-day comfort.
- Is the villa suited for all ages and accessibility needs? Spacious, single-level layouts or ground-floor suites might be essential for some guests.
- Are there personalized experiences on offer? Many luxury properties can arrange private chefs, guided nature walks, or even evening bonfire setups, perfect for rounding out our adventure.
Researching recent guest reviews is wise. Genuine feedback sheds light on what it’s like to combine villa living with equestrian experiences in that area. We also advise booking ahead of peak seasons, so we have our pick of the most desirable accommodations.
